l'appel de succès, erreur de rappels à l'aide de souscrire en angular2?
Donnant responce.json () n'est pas la fonction pour mon cas
composant.ts
this.AuthService.loginAuth(this.data).subscribe(function(response) {
console.log("Success Response" + response)
},
function(error) {
console.log("Error happened" + error)
},
function() {
console.log("the subscription is completed")
});
AuthService.ts
loginAuth(data): Observable<any> {
return this.request('POST', 'http://192.168.2.122/bapi/public/api/auth/login', data,{ headers:this. headers })
.map(response => response)
//...errors if any
.catch(this.handleError);
}
Donner [de l'objet,objet]
Si j'ai mis la carte la fonction de service comme .carte(réponse => la réponse.json()) est de donner de l'erreur comme responce.json () n'est pas la fonction
S'il vous plaît aider moi
OriginalL'auteur Runali | 2017-02-13
Vous devez vous connecter pour publier un commentaire.
Essayez d'utiliser cette structure:
Vous pouvez aussi stringify vos données sont envoyées vers le serveur tels que:
Et vous devez déclarer une variable dans le constructeur de votre service de référencement Http comme tel:
C'est la façon dont il a travaillé pour moi
OriginalL'auteur Rossco
Dans votre page de service
Et votre modèle de fichier ts
Ça fonctionne parfaitement pour moi
OriginalL'auteur bipin patel